Theme is Inverted if First File Preview is in Dark Mode

If your Mac is already in Dark Mode when you preview a file, the theme is inverted for every file you preview until you relaunch Finder, change your system to Light Mode, and then preview your first file.

I've been having this issue for quite a while too. The light theme at the first launch is permanently set, and changing to another light theme in the app doesn't change any of the files' themes.

Edit: Changing the render from RTF to HTML works as a temporary fix. Also, I can't solve the problem with the solution in OP's comment (relaunching Finder and changing the system theme).
